57 more posts of doctors for Tiruchi medical college
The Health Department has sanctioned 57 posts in three
categories to the K.A.P. Viswanatham Government Medical College and
Hospital here. Twenty one posts of Associate Professor, 17 posts of
Assistant Professor, and 19 posts of tutor have been sanctioned to the
college and hospital.
The posts were newly created in the college consequent to the increase in the number of intake of students from 100 to 150.
P.
Karkuzhali, Dean of the college, said the creation of new posts would
benefit both the students of the college and the patients at the
hospital as the teaching faculty would treat patients.
Sharp increase
The
Dean said there had been a sharp increase in the admission of patients
at the hospital in various wards, consequent to the upgrade of various
infrastructure in terms of buildings, equipment, and she particularly
referred to the New-born Intensive Care Unit (NICU) which has
state-of-the-art facilities.
Listing the
achievements of NICU, she said the NICU had been instrumental in
handling the pre-mature babies, underweight infants, and newborns with
complications, including jaundice.
D. Swaminathan,
Head of Department of Paediatrics, said the infant mortality rate had
been reduced to a great extent after the provision of the NICU. A
constant surveillance was being kept by the medical and paramedical
personnel using 51 warmers and LED phototherapy and other equipment
available.
Complications
P. Kanagaraj, Medical
Superintendent, and J. Sathya, Associate Professor, said low-birth
weight was one of the major complications.
The
facilities available at the hospital had been attracting a large number
of patients and pregnant women from neighbouring districts, they said.
